Medical Devices
A medical device is used to treat a disease or illness. It is used to determine an abnormal physical condition, or to prevent it from occurring. While many medical devices are safe, a few might be unsafe and cause harm to patients. If a patient is injured by a medical device injury, they are entitled to compensation for their losses.
The FDA must approve and review medical devices just as it does for drugs. However the current system is laced with many loopholes that allow dangerous medical products to reach the hands of patients. For instance, the FDA's 501(k) approval process allows medical device manufacturers to speed up the development of their products if a comparable product has been approved by the FDA. Many of the devices associated with large class action lawsuits, such as metal-on-metal hip replacements, have received initial FDA approval through this program.

In the event that a medicine has been discovered to be dangerous or unsafe It is commonplace for thousands of people to file suit against the manufacturer. These cases are brought together by an federal court and handled under the umbrella of a multidistrict litigation. These cases often extend over lengthy periods of time, due to the complexities of these cases.
In these cases, the victim are able to receive a settlement to cover their medical costs and lost income, as well as discomfort and pain, and other damages. In some cases, punitive damages could be awarded. These damages are meant as a punishment to the defendant and to send a clear message that this kind of conduct will not be tolerated in the future.
